Sailor Boy’s Letter From Newport 1905

Lexie Morris, Apprentice seaman, writes from the U.S. Navy Training School in Newport Rhode Island describing travel from Norfolk to New York and Newport, twenty one day quarantine, transfer plans to the New Barracks, observation of ships Charleston Texas Galveston Monitor and torpedo boats, a 410 by 93 foot transport, first class passage, mountain travel with tunnels, and routines of light duty, library access, and guard duty aboard ship life.

Automatic Telephone System Introduced by Marion Merchants

Marion merchants form a stock company to install an automatic telephone setup with no hello girl at central. Users simply signal from their office or dwelling, lift the receiver to call, and busy lines show. The system prevents overlapping calls and immediately readjusts after a user hangs up.

Election of Road Supervisors to be Held December 16

The article notes a December 16 election for district road supervisors under township trustees. Supervisors oversee township roads distinct from county road superintendents, who manage country or free gravel roads. The piece emphasizes the small yet important offices and the need for voter participation.

Thanksgiving Date Dispute Based On Late November Calendar

The piece notes calendar differences for Thanksgiving with dates Nov 23 or Nov 30. It explains last Thursday proclamations by the president versus the Thursday after the third Tuesday. It also reflects on delaying turkey orders until Roosevelt’s proclamation. The column muses on hometown pride and people moving away and back.

Aunt Rebecca Jaques 80th Birthday Celebration

A rural community gathers at Aunt Rebecca Jaques's home two and a half miles north of Advance to mark her eightieth birthday. Relatives travel from Crawfordsville and Kokomo for a noon dinner, shared gifts, and a day of smiles before evening departures.
